随着科技的不断发展,人工智能(AI)已经成为了当今社会的热门话题,在这场技术革命中,华为云作为全球领先的云服务提供商,正致力于将AI技术应用于软件开发领域,以期为用户带来全新的体验,在贾永利的带领下,华为云正在通过AI技术,为软件开发行业创造一个崭新的未来。
AI在软件开发中的应用
1、自动化编码
AI技术可以通过学习大量的代码库,自动生成代码,从而提高软件开发的效率,这种自动化编码技术可以帮助开发人员快速构建原型,减少重复性工作,让他们更专注于解决复杂问题。
2、智能代码审查
AI技术可以辅助开发人员进行代码审查,通过分析代码库中的模式和潜在问题,提高代码质量,AI还可以根据历史数据,预测可能出现的问题,从而帮助开发人员提前修复潜在的缺陷。
3、智能测试
AI技术可以自动生成测试用例,覆盖更多的测试场景,提高测试效率,AI还可以通过分析测试结果,自动定位问题,帮助开发人员快速修复缺陷。
4、个性化推荐
AI技术可以根据用户的需求和行为,为用户提供个性化的软件推荐,这不仅可以提高用户的满意度,还可以帮助开发者更好地了解用户需求,优化产品设计。
华为云在AI领域的布局
1、投入大量资源
华为云在AI领域投入了大量的资源,包括人才、资金和技术,这使得华为云在AI技术上取得了显著的成果,为软件开发行业带来了革命性的变革。
2、开放平台
华为云推出了开放的AI平台,为开发者提供了丰富的API和SDK,使得开发者可以轻松地将AI技术应用于自己的项目中。
3、合作共赢
华为云积极与全球众多合作伙伴展开合作,共同推动AI技术在软件开发领域的应用,通过合作共赢,华为云为软件开发行业带来了更多的创新机会。
未来展望
随着AI技术的不断发展,我们有理由相信,未来的软件开发将变得更加智能化、高效化,在华为云等企业的推动下,AI技术将为软件开发行业带来更多的创新和突破,为用户带来更加美好的体验。
相关问题与解答
问题1:AI技术在软件开发中有哪些优势?
答:AI技术在软件开发中的优势主要体现在以下几个方面:提高开发效率、提高代码质量、提高测试效率和提供个性化推荐,这些优势可以帮助开发人员更好地应对软件开发过程中的各种挑战,提高整体的开发效率。
问题2:华为云在AI领域的布局有哪些?
答:华为云在AI领域的布局主要包括:投入大量资源、推出开放的AI平台和与合作伙伴共赢,通过这些布局,华为云为软件开发行业带来了革命性的变革,推动了AI技术在软件开发领域的广泛应用。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/280939.html